The global magnetic refrigeration market size is expected to reach USD 8.32 Billion in 2034 from USD 1.25 Billion in 2025, growing at a CAGR of 23.44 during 2026-2034.The global magnetic refrigeration market is poised for significant growth, driven by the increasing demand for energy-efficient cooling technologies. Magnetic refrigeration is an innovative cooling method that utilizes the magnetocaloric effect to achieve temperature changes, offering a more environmentally friendly alternative to traditional vapor-compression refrigeration systems. As industries and consumers seek to reduce energy consumption and minimize greenhouse gas emissions, the adoption of magnetic refrigeration technologies is expected to rise significantly, fostering innovation and investment in this emerging market.
Moreover, advancements in magnetic materials and system designs are set to transform the magnetic refrigeration landscape. The development of high-performance magnetocaloric materials and efficient heat exchange systems is enhancing the effectiveness and applicability of magnetic refrigeration across various sectors, including residential, commercial, and industrial cooling applications. Additionally, the growing focus on sustainable refrigeration solutions is driving research and development efforts aimed at improving the performance and cost-effectiveness of magnetic refrigeration systems. As the market continues to evolve, the demand for innovative magnetic refrigeration solutions that offer superior energy efficiency will remain strong.
In addition, the increasing emphasis on regulatory compliance and environmental sustainability is expected to shape the future of the magnetic refrigeration market. As governments implement stricter regulations on refrigerants and promote the adoption of eco-friendly cooling technologies, the demand for magnetic refrigeration systems that align with these initiatives will continue to rise. Collaborative efforts between manufacturers, research institutions, and regulatory agencies will be essential in driving these advancements, ensuring that the magnetic refrigeration market remains at the forefront of sustainable cooling technologies.
